Another suggestion:

Put a TeX box immediately in front of each table, containing the command
\newstylenums{
And immediately after the table, a TeX box containing just a single
}


This works for me. All numbers in the entire table becomes new style.
This may be some work for an entire book, but it sure is easier
than using latex commands for each and every little number.

Everything between two such boxes is typeset newstyle, so
if there are several tables and a little text (without numbers),
consider saving work by enclosing the whole group with just
the two boxes.

I have not tested what happens if the tables are inside floats,
maybe you have to use \newstylenums in each float then.
